An industry-leading, AI-first technology platform in the intellectual property space is hiring a Staff-Level ML Engineer to lead all Data and NLP initiatives. This company was an early adopter of Large Language Models and is building advanced, agentic AI workflows that autonomously answer complex research questions. The platform combines proprietary ML models with cutting-edge NLP techniques to deliver high-precision search and insights at scale.

The Role

  • Own and improve search performance (precision & recall)
  • Optimise large-scale search algorithms for speed and relevance
  • Design and implement agentic LLM workflows
  • Build and maintain robust data pipelines
  • Lead model development, training, and deployment
  • Provide technical leadership across ML and NLP initiatives

This is a high-impact, hands-on leadership role in a product-driven AI company.

Requirements

  • 8+ years of commercial experience in engineering and data science
  • Proven technical leadership experience
  • Commercial Machine Learning experience
  • Deep experience in Natural Language Processing (NLP)
  • Experience training models in TensorFlow and PyTorch
  • Experience with search databases (Elasticsearch, OpenSearch, etc.)
  • Experience with AWS or similar cloud platforms
  • Willingness to work 3 days per week onsite in London
